19 Dec 2006 WhiteWater World unveiled on Gold Coast BY Helen Patenall |
![]() WhiteWater World – the new water park adjacent to Dreamworld theme park on Australia’s Gold Coast – has opened. The four-hectare, AUS$60m (£24m, US$46m, 36m euro) park boasts a beach theme designed to celebrate Australia’s surfing culture. It is a separately gated attraction to Dreamworld but a new Two Day World Pass includes entry to both parks. A series of curriculum-based student courses are also set to be implemented at WhiteWater World next year, offering primary and senior students a series of science, maths, chemistry and water conservation programmes. Rides include the Super Tubes Hydrocoaster, the Bro, the Green Room, the Rip, the Temple of Huey, the Cave of Waves, Nickelodeon Pipeline Plunge and Wiggle Bay.
